Why do you want to accumulate miles? You could get a cash back cc and buy the tickets you want with the cash you save.
You can get a credit card that allows you to "buy" tickets on any airline.
You can get a credit card that gives you miles on a particular airline.

I've chosen to stick with one airline and get status on that airline. I get free baggage, early boarding (great if you have carry-ons), and "preferred seats." That means you have to stay with one airline (or alliance). Occasionally I get upgrades.

My sister and BIL don't fly a lot, not enough to make elite. They have a cc that lets them buy tickets on the cheapest airline. Because my BIL puts all his business expenses on that, they have plenty of points to fly to Europe once a year.

What is best for one person may not make sense for another.
